Klocki hamulcowe EBC Racing RP-X to ultra wydajne klocki hamulcowe na tor wyścigowy, specjalna mieszanka zaprojektowana dla ciężkich samochodów wyczynowych jeżdżących ekstremalnie po torze oraz dedykowanych samochodów wyścigowych. Klocki hamulcowe EBC Racing RP-X mają bardzo stabilny współczynnik tarcia 0,55mu i są zdolne do pracy w temperaturach w zakresie od 0°C do 850°C bez obniżenia skuteczności hamowania, co czyni je doskonałymi klockami hamulcowym nawet do najbardziej wymagających zastosowań.

Klocki hamulcowe EBC Racing RP-X mają również wysoki współczynnik tarcia w niskiej temperaturze, nie wymagając rozgrzania, aby osiągnąć maksymalny efekt hamowania, co sprawia, że dobrze nadają się do wyścigów sprinterskich (np. Drag racing) i górskich. RP-X nie mają homologacji R90 do użytku na drogach publicznych w krajach członkowskich UE, jednakże materiał klocków ma doskonałe właściwości w niskich temperaturach, oznacza to, że RP-X mogą być bezpiecznie używane do jazdy w wyścigach oraz innych wydarzeniach samochodowych, gdzie pozwalają na to lokalne przepisy.

EBC Racing RP-X zostały opracowane z myślą o maksymalnej wydajności na torze, co oznacza, że należy oczekiwać wyższego pylenia i hałasu hamowania. RP-X ma porównywalne zużycie tarcz hamulcowych z wieloma innymi popularnymi klockami hamulcowymi przeznaczonymi do wyścigów. 

Zużycie klocków RP-X jest większe niż w przypadku innych klocków hamulcowych np. w porównaniu z klockami EBC Racing RP-1, co powoduje wysoki poziom pylenia, w porównaniu do klocków RP-1, klocki RP-X mają 25-procentowy wzrost współczynnika tarcia w całym zakresie temperatur roboczych przy znacznie mniejszym nacisku na pedał hamulca. Fakt ten sprawia, że RP-X jest agresywniejszym klockiem w początkowej fazie hamowania.

W przypadku samochodów o małej lub średniej masie, bez zamontowanych zestawów hamulcowych EBC Big Brake Kit lub samochodów bez ABS, zalecamy mniej agresywne klocki hamulcowe -  EBC Racing RP-1.
